Wage information comes from the Bureau of Labor Statistics, Occupational Employment Statistics Program. The OES is a semi-annual survey that provides wage and employment statistics for the nation, each state, and sub-state regions.

      Wages for Physician Assistants in NEW MEXICO

      Location Pay
      Period
      2024
      10% 25% Median 75% 90%
      United States Hourly $45.79 $54.70 $64.07 $77.00 $87.60
      Yearly $95,240 $113,770 $133,260 $160,160 $182,200
      New Mexico Hourly $45.98 $57.01 $67.30 $78.78 $107.33
      Yearly $95,640 $118,580 $139,990 $163,870 $223,250
      Santa Fe, NM Metro Area Hourly $51.60 $59.33 $67.63 $77.45 $85.20
      Yearly $107,320 $123,410 $140,670 $161,100 $177,210
      Northern New Mexico Balance of State Hourly $46.05 $60.85 $67.32 $75.97 $94.23
      Yearly $95,790 $126,570 $140,020 $158,020 $196,000
      Farmington, NM Metro Area Hourly $47.07 $59.51 $66.92 $72.82 $76.76
      Yearly $97,910 $123,790 $139,190 $151,470 $159,660
      Albuquerque, NM Metro Area Hourly $42.24 $55.85 $64.91 $80.19 $115.00+
      Yearly $87,860 $116,170 $135,020 $166,800 $239,200+
      Eastern New Mexico Balance of State Hourly $47.45 $55.58 $62.89 $75.46 $83.65
      Yearly $98,690 $115,610 $130,800 $156,970 $173,980
